Kash Patel Faces Backlash Following Missteps in Charlie Kirk Assassination Investigation

9/13/2025, 1:19:55 PM

Overview of the Incident

FBI Director Kash Patel is under intense scrutiny following his handling of the investigation into the assassination of conservative activist Charlie Kirk, who was shot on September 10, 2025, during an event at Utah Valley University. The alleged shooter, Tyler Robinson, was arrested after a tip from a family member, not through FBI efforts. Patel's premature announcement on social media that a suspect was in custody led to confusion and criticism from various quarters, including former allies within the MAGA movement.

Timeline of Events

  • September 10, 2025: Charlie Kirk is shot during a public event.
  • September 10, 2025: Kash Patel tweets that a suspect is in custody, which is later contradicted by local law enforcement.
  • September 11, 2025: Patel convenes a tense online meeting with over 200 agents, expressing frustration over delayed information regarding the suspect.
  • September 12, 2025: Tyler Robinson is arrested after his father contacts law enforcement.

Criticism of Kash Patel's Leadership

Patel's leadership has been called into question by various figures, including conservatives. Critics argue that his initial announcement was misleading and that the FBI's response was inadequate. Steve Bannon remarked that the arrest was not a result of effective law enforcement but rather family intervention. Christopher Rufo, a conservative activist, stated, “He performed terribly in the last few days, and it’s not clear whether he has the operational expertise to investigate... violent movements.”

Official Statements & Responses

The FBI has maintained that they are working closely with local law enforcement to resolve the case. A spokesperson stated, “The FBI worked with our law enforcement partners in Utah to bring to justice the individual allegedly responsible for the horrific murder of Charlie Kirk.” However, a White House source criticized Patel's performance as "unprofessional," indicating that it would be addressed internally.

Conflicting Reports & Gaps

There are discrepancies regarding the timeline of events and the effectiveness of the FBI's response. While Patel claimed that the FBI had numerous leads, critics pointed out that the actual arrest was facilitated by a family member's tip rather than FBI efforts. Additionally, Patel's initial claim of a suspect in custody was quickly retracted, leading to confusion among the public and media.

What's Next

Kash Patel is scheduled to testify before the House and Senate Judiciary Committees on September 16, 2025. Lawmakers are expected to question him about the Kirk investigation, his management of the FBI, and the ongoing allegations of political retaliation within the bureau. The fallout from this incident may have lasting implications for Patel's tenure as FBI Director, particularly given the increasing scrutiny from both political allies and opponents.
